WebJan 25, 2024 · STEP 1: Remove drawers and sand dresser First, I removed all three of my drawers and set them aside. I was going to keep one of the drawers (the top one) so I made sure to keep that one close by because I would need to sand it eventually, too. Then, using a palm sander with fine grit sandpaper, I sanded the entire dresser. WebDec 22, 2024 · ‘A popular method of building a DIY kitchen island is to make one out of kitchen cabinets. If you plan on going this route, you can buy any combination of kitchen cabinets as long as they don't have a countertop already attached. This gives you flexibility to combine cabinets the way you want by adding a countertop. WebMar 28, 2024 · Measure their depth and width. 2. Figure out the dimensions of your countertop. Decide how long you want the countertop to be. WebJan 15, 2024 · For assembling the island, we really recommend following our plans, but here is a quick tip: to make sure the apron is completely centered on the legs, cut spacers and clamp everything together. That way it won’t shift as you add the screws! We built the ends first, then attached them with the bottom shelf support. WebJul 4, 2024 · Smaller kitchen islands should be secured to the floor so they do not slide or tilt if someone leans or pushes against the island. If you turn a standard kitchen island base cabinet upside down, you will discover a void space about 4-inches deep.
